CGRC exam at a glance

  • Questions: 125 items (100 scored + 25 unscored pretest)
  • Time: 3 hours
  • Passing score: 700 out of 1000 (scaled)
  • Cost: $249 USD (Americas); recertify every 3 years with 60 CPE credits plus a $135 annual maintenance fee

What’s on the CGRC cheat sheet

  • GRC & Compliance Program (16%) governance, risk management, frameworks and laws, and the RMF Prepare step — the foundation domain.
  • Scope of the System (10%) the authorization boundary, information types, and FIPS 199 categorization with the high-water mark.
  • Selection & Approval of Controls (14%) the FIPS 199 → FIPS 200 → 800-53B baseline → tailoring flow, plus common, compensating, and overlay controls.
  • Implementation of Controls (17%) deploying and documenting controls in the System Security Plan (SSP) — the heaviest domain.
  • Assessment/Audit of Controls (16%) the SCA, the Examine/Interview/Test methods, and the SAR feeding the POA&M.
  • System Compliance (14%) the authorization package, the RMF roles, and the ATO, ATO-with-conditions, DATO, and IATT decisions.
  • Compliance Maintenance (13%) continuous monitoring (ISCM), change management with security impact analysis, and secure decommissioning.

How to use it in your final week

  • Memorize the RMF spine cold — Prepare, Categorize, Select, Implement, Assess, Authorize, Monitor — because every domain maps to one step and many items ask for the best next step.
  • Front-load Implementation (17%), the GRC program (16%), and Assessment (16%): together they are about half the exam, so drill these three before the lighter domains.
  • Lock in the three high-frequency rules the morning of the exam — the FIPS 199 high-water mark, the SSP + SAR + POA&M authorization package, and the separation rule (the SCA assesses, the AO accepts the risk).
  • Pair each review pass with a short timed practice set so scenario pacing across the 3-hour, 125-question window feels routine.
